Understanding immunology is increasingly important in obstetrics and gynecology. Written primarily to meet the needs of practicing obstetricians and gynecologists, this book explores the role of immunological processes in reproduction. It is organized into six sections: basic immunology; the immunological paradox of pregnancy; disorders with a putative immunologic basis in obstetric and gynecologic practice; the immune system and cancer; immunopathology; and immunological tests in obstetrics and gynecology. The book presents immunologic concepts and illustrates important points with examples familiar to the clinician. For example, the immunology behind the simple pregnancy test will be used to explain a range of concepts including what antibodies and antigens are, how they interact, and what is their central role in the disease process.
